  • Developer-Friendly Hosting
    Opalstack is designed with developers in mind, offering SSH access, Git integration, and support for multiple programming languages and frameworks including Python, Node.js, Ruby, and PHP, giving developers granular control over their hosting environment.
  • Affordable Pricing
    Opalstack offers competitive pricing for shared and managed hosting plans, making it an accessible option for small businesses, freelancers, and individual developers who need robust features without enterprise-level costs.
  • Modern Control Panel
    Opalstack provides a clean, modern, and intuitive web-based dashboard for managing sites, applications, databases, and email accounts, which is a significant improvement over older-style hosting control panels like cPanel.
  • Strong Support for Multiple Applications
    The platform supports a wide variety of application types including WordPress, Django, Flask, Express, static sites, and more, allowing users to host diverse projects on a single account with easy deployment.
  • Reliable Infrastructure and Support
    Opalstack is built by former WebFaction team members, bringing experienced hosting expertise. They offer responsive customer support and a reputation for stable, well-managed server infrastructure with good uptime.

Possible disadvantages

  • Smaller Community and Ecosystem
    Compared to major hosting providers like DigitalOcean, AWS, or even shared hosts like SiteGround, Opalstack has a smaller user base, which means fewer community tutorials, third-party guides, and forum discussions available for troubleshooting.
  • Limited Scalability Options
    Opalstack is primarily a shared hosting provider, which means it may not be the best choice for high-traffic applications or projects that require rapid, on-demand scaling of resources like CPU, RAM, or storage.
  • Not Ideal for Beginners
    While developer-friendly, Opalstack's approach can be intimidating for non-technical users. Setting up applications often requires familiarity with the command line and server configuration, which may not suit those looking for simple one-click solutions.
  • Limited Data Center Locations
    Opalstack offers a relatively small number of data center locations compared to major cloud providers, which may result in higher latency for users targeting audiences in regions not well-served by the available server locations.
  • Fewer Managed Services and Add-ons
    Unlike larger hosting platforms, Opalstack lacks a wide range of managed add-on services such as built-in CDN integration, managed backups with granular restore options, or one-click SSL management that more mainstream providers offer out of the box.
  • Source-backed research reports
    Structured company reports with citations from filings, annual reports, earnings calls, and company materials.
  • Portfolio monitoring
    Ongoing tracking of watched companies, portfolio context, and key fundamental developments.
  • Earnings summaries
    Concise post-earnings updates focused on management commentary, results, and traceable sources.

Overall verdict

  • Opalstack is a solid choice for developers and tech-savvy users seeking an affordable, flexible control panel hosting solution with good performance and transparent pricing, though it may require more technical know-how than mainstream cPanel hosts.

Why this product is good

  • Uses a custom lightweight control panel that's fast and efficient compared to resource-heavy alternatives like cPanel
  • Offers straightforward, transparent pricing without hidden fees or aggressive upselling
  • Provides SSD storage and solid server performance for the price point
  • Supports multiple app types including Python, Node.js, and various frameworks beyond typical PHP hosting
  • Founded by the original creators of WebFaction, bringing significant hosting industry experience
  • Good for running multiple websites/apps under one account with granular resource control
  • Responsive customer support with a knowledgeable team
  • No long-term contracts required, allowing flexibility

Recommended for

  • Developers who need support for Python, Node.js, or other non-PHP applications
  • Users comfortable with a more technical, non-cPanel control panel interface
  • Small businesses or freelancers hosting multiple websites who want granular control
  • Former WebFaction users looking for a similar service after its shutdown
  • Budget-conscious users who want VPS-like flexibility without full server management
  • Users who prioritize transparent pricing over bundled marketing extras
